Maintaining synthetic chlorinated swimming pools necessitates regular checking of chlorine levels and h2o quality. Pool operators and homeowners must Verify the chlorine concentration frequently to ensure it stays within the recommended range. Much too minimal chlorine may lead to insufficient sanitation, making it possible for microorganisms and algae to thrive. On the other hand, too much chlorine degrees can result in skin and eye discomfort for swimmers. The perfect chlorine level for synthetic chlorinated pools ordinarily falls involving 1 and three areas per million (ppm). Protecting this stability is important for delivering a comfortable and Harmless swimming knowledge.

As well as chlorine concentrations, artificial chlorinated swimming pools need good pH stability. The pH of pool h2o ought to Preferably be between 7.two and seven.6. If your pH is too lower, the h2o turns into acidic, bringing about corrosion of pool gear and distress for swimmers. If the pH is too significant, chlorine becomes considerably less helpful, lowering its capacity to sanitize the h2o. Frequent testing and adjustment of pH amounts enable ensure that artificial chlorinated pools remain effectively-balanced and cozy for end users. Pool house owners normally use pH tests kits and chemical changes to take care of the appropriate pH concentrations in their swimming pools.

Another vital element of synthetic chlorinated pools is using st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ade quickly when subjected to sunlight, reducing its performance like a disinfectant. To combat this, pool entrepreneurs generally incorporate c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that helps extend the lifetime of chlorine in outdoor swimming pools. With no stabilizers, chlorine ranges can fall rapidly, necessitating Recurrent additions to take care of appropriate sanitation. By utilizing the ideal level of stabilizer, synthetic chlorinated swimming pools can continue to be cleaner for extended intervals with minimum chlorine reduction.

Artificial chlorinated pools also have to have routine upkeep outside of chemical balancing. Filtration units play an important role in maintaining the water thoroughly clean by eliminating particles, Grime, and natural and organic issue. Pool filters, like s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, support lure impurities and prevent them from circulating during the drinking water. Typical cleansing and backwashing of filters assure they purpose effectively. Additionally, pool owners really should skim the water floor, vacuum the pool ground, and brush the pool walls to forestall algae buildup and preserve drinking water clarity. Proper upkeep helps artificial chlorinated pools stay in best situation for swimmers.

In recent times, There was an elevated focus on eco-pleasant remedies for synthetic chlorinated swimming pools. Some pool house owners and operators are Checking out methods to decrease chemical usage although keeping drinking water excellent. One option is the use of ozone or ultraviolet (UV) light methods, which perform alongside chlorine to boost disinfection and decrease the amount of chemicals needed. These methods assist stop working contaminants and cut down chlorine byproducts, earning the drinking water gentler about the skin and eyes. Furthermore, improvements in filtration technological innovation have improved the efficiency of h2o circulation and purification, contributing to cleaner and a lot more sustainable pool upkeep practices.

Regardless of the several advantages of synthetic chlorinated pools, it can be crucial for pool house owners and operators to stick to safety pointers and greatest practices. Right storage and handling of chlorine and other pool chemical compounds are essential to forestall accidents and chemical imbalances. Chlorine really should be stored in the awesome, dry position far from immediate daylight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other chemicals, for instance ammonia or acids, can produce unsafe reactions. Pool routine maintenance personnel must be trained in chemical security and observe recommended tips for dealing with and software.
